When you’re up against a foreclosure, having a seasoned guide can reveal several potential solutions. Here’s how we can approach your situation:
- Strategic Defense: We meticulously review every document and action taken by your lender. Was every ‘i’ dotted and ‘t’ crossed according to New York law? Sometimes, procedural missteps by the lender can provide leverage or even grounds for dismissal.
- Negotiating New Terms (Loan Modification): Imagine reshaping your current mortgage to fit your current reality. We work with lenders to argue for adjusted payment plans, potentially lowering your monthly dues or interest rates through a formal loan modification. This often involves preparing detailed financial statements and hardship letters.
- Exploring dignified exits (Short Sale/Deed in Lieu): If keeping the home isn’t the preferred route, a short sale allows you to sell your home for less than the total mortgage balance, with the lender’s approval. Alternatively, a deed in lieu of foreclosure lets you voluntarily transfer the property title back to the lender, often a quicker and less damaging process than a full foreclosure.
- Seeking Court Protection (Bankruptcy): Filing for Chapter 13 bankruptcy can immediately halt foreclosure proceedings. This legal shield provides an opportunity to reorganize debts and propose a repayment plan, often allowing homeowners to catch up on missed payments over several years.
